虚拟主机数据库容量超限应对指南
一、问题表现与影响
当虚拟主机数据库容量超出限制时,主要表现为查询速度骤降、功能模块异常、存储报警触发等。这可能导致网页加载时间延长40%-60%,用户流失率上升,严重时触发服务商的账户暂停机制。
二、清理与优化策略
优先执行空间释放操作:
- 删除过期日志和临时文件(CMS系统建议保留周期≤90天)
- 压缩历史数据至原体积的30%-50%(建议使用gzip或Brotli算法)
- 清理冗余索引,合并碎片化数据表
数据库结构优化需注意:使用InnoDB引擎时建议配置innodb_file_per_table,并定期执行OPTIMIZE TABLE命令。
三、存储扩展方案
- 垂直扩容:升级至支持SSD存储的高性能套餐(推荐增幅≥50%)
- 水平扩展:将静态资源迁移至CDN或对象存储服务(可释放30%-70%空间)
- 混合架构:建立热数据(主库)+冷数据(归档库)的分级存储体系
四、长期维护机制
建立容量监控预警系统,建议设置80%容量阈值报警。通过crontab配置自动化清理脚本,对日志文件实施滚动删除策略。每月执行数据库健康检查,包括:
- 索引效率分析
- 存储引擎状态检测
- 备份文件完整性验证
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/688653.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。